Maldita Nerea will present her new album in Salamanca: “A Planet Called Us”.

The concert will be on Saturday, May 2 at the Center for the Performing Arts and Music of the city.

Jorge Ruiz, Luis Gómez, Rafa Martín, Tato Latorre and Serginho Moreira will act after more than two years without releasing a new album.

"A planet called us" is an incredible leap within his record career. Paco Salazar will produce this work, with a text that delves into the outstanding potential of the human being. "It takes more people like you, and less fear" is the standard phrase of the lyrics of the single that transmits an unusual force and energy in anyone who stops to listen to it. "It is a commitment to who we are, to everything that the word Us represents," says the author.

Maldita Nerea is one of the reference pop bands in Spanish music. It has one million listeners a month on Spotify, 140 million views on YouTube and 1 million followers on social networks. Platinum records and multiple singles, Maldita Nerea has received several awards Number 1 of Chain 100 or Top 40. In the Plaza Mayor of Salamanca he performed in 2017.
